Che cos'è un ListView in Android?

Una vista elenco è una vista adattatore che non conosce i dettagli, come tipo e contenuto, delle viste che contiene. La visualizzazione elenco richiede invece visualizzazioni su richiesta da un ListAdapter in base alle esigenze, ad esempio per visualizzare nuove visualizzazioni mentre l'utente scorre verso l'alto o verso il basso. Per visualizzare gli elementi nell'elenco, chiama setAdapter(android.

Cos'è ListView in Android con l'esempio?

Android ListView è un ViewGroup che è utilizzato per visualizzare l'elenco di elementi in più righe e contiene un adattatore che inserisce automaticamente gli elementi nell'elenco.
...
attività_principale. xml.

Parametro Descrizione
Gestione l'ID risorsa per un file di layout
oggetti oggetti da visualizzare in ListView

Cosa intendi per ListView?

Android ListView è una vista che raggruppa più elementi e li visualizza in un elenco a scorrimento verticale. Gli elementi dell'elenco vengono inseriti automaticamente nell'elenco utilizzando un adattatore che estrae il contenuto da un'origine come un array o un database.

Qual è la differenza tra spinner e ListView in Android?

Gli spinner forniscono un modo rapido per selezionare un valore da un set. Nello stato predefinito, a lo spinner mostra il suo attualmente selezionato valore. Toccando lo spinner viene visualizzato un menu a tendina con tutti gli altri valori disponibili, dal quale l'utente può selezionarne uno nuovo. ListView è un gruppo di viste che visualizza un elenco di elementi scorrevoli.

ListView è deprecato in Android?

Conclusione. Sebbene ListView sia ancora una vista molto capace, per i nuovi progetti ti consiglio vivamente di utilizzare RecyclerView e considerare ListView come deprecato. Non riesco a pensare a nessuna situazione in cui ListView sia migliore di RecyclerView, anche se implementi ListView con il modello ViewHolder.

Qual è la differenza tra ListView e RecyclerView?

Sommario. RecyclerView ha maggiore supporto per LayoutManagement inclusi elenchi verticali, elenchi orizzontali, griglie e griglie sfalsate. ListView supporta solo elenchi verticali. ListView inizia per impostazione predefinita con i divisori tra gli elementi e richiede la personalizzazione per aggiungere decorazioni.

Qual è l'uso di GridView in Android?

GridView in Android con esempio. Un GridView è un tipo di AdapterView che visualizza gli elementi in una griglia a scorrimento bidimensionale. Gli elementi vengono inseriti in questo layout di griglia da un database o da un array. L'adattatore viene utilizzato per visualizzare questi dati, il metodo setAdapter() viene utilizzato per unire l'adattatore con GridView.

Che cos'è il toast in Android?

Un brindisi Android è un piccolo messaggio visualizzato sullo schermo, simile a una descrizione comando o ad un'altra notifica popup simile. Un brindisi viene visualizzato sopra il contenuto principale di un'attività e rimane visibile solo per un breve periodo di tempo.

Che cos'è un layout in Android?

Layout Parte di Android Jetpack. Un layout definisce la struttura per un'interfaccia utente nell'app, ad esempio in un'attività. Tutti gli elementi del layout vengono creati utilizzando una gerarchia di oggetti View e ViewGroup. Una vista di solito disegna qualcosa che l'utente può vedere e con cui interagire.

Che cos'è un Android RecyclerView?

RecyclerView è il ViewGroup che contiene le viste corrispondenti ai tuoi dati. È una vista stessa, quindi aggiungi RecyclerView al tuo layout nello stesso modo in cui aggiungeresti qualsiasi altro elemento dell'interfaccia utente. … Dopo che il supporto della vista è stato creato, RecyclerView lo associa ai suoi dati. Definisci il supporto della vista estendendo RecyclerView.

Quando si fa clic su un pulsante, quale listener è possibile utilizzare?

Se si dispone di più di un evento clic del pulsante, è possibile utilizzare la maiuscola per identificare il pulsante su cui si è fatto clic. Collega il pulsante dall'XML chiamando il metodo findViewById() e imposta il ascoltatore onClick utilizzando il metodo setOnClickListener(). setOnClickListener accetta un oggetto OnClickListener come parametro.

Quale controllo mostra la visualizzazione dell'elemento attualmente selezionato in Android?

Spinners forniscono un modo rapido per selezionare un valore da un determinato insieme di valori e, nello stato predefinito, uno spinner mostra solo il valore attualmente selezionato. Quando si tocca (tocca) lo spinner, viene visualizzato un menu a discesa con tutti gli altri valori (opzioni) disponibili, dal quale l'utente può selezionarne uno nuovo.

Che cos'è la risorsa in Android?

Nell'Android, quasi tutto è una risorsa. … Le risorse vengono utilizzate per qualsiasi cosa, dalla definizione di colori, immagini, layout, menu e valori di stringa. Il valore di questo è che nulla è hardcoded. Tutto è definito in questi file di risorse e quindi può essere referenziato all'interno del codice dell'applicazione.

RecyclerView è più veloce di ListView?

Il RecyclerView è molto più potente, flessibile e un importante miglioramento rispetto a ListView. Secondo il sito degli sviluppatori Android, RecyclerView è stato aggiunto nella versione 22.1. 0 e appartiene a Maven artefact com. androide.
...
ListView vs RecyclerView

  • Layout Manager. …
  • Animatore di oggetti. …
  • Decorazione dell'oggetto. …
  • OnItemTouch Listener. …
  • Prestazioni al caricamento.

Devo usare ListView o RecyclerView?

Se stai scrivendo una nuova interfaccia utente, potresti stare meglio con RiciclatoreVedi. RecyclerView è potente quando devi personalizzare il tuo elenco o desideri animazioni migliori. Quei metodi convenienti in ListView hanno causato molti problemi alle persone, motivo per cui RecyclerView fornisce loro una soluzione più flessibile.

Ti piace questo post? Per favore condividi con i tuoi amici:
Sistema operativo oggi